Getting to Know the Players: Components of the Slide Assembly

The slide assembly isn’t a single piece but rather a system of interconnected parts working in harmony. Each component has a specific role, and their combined function drives the shotgun’s cycling action. Disassembling, cleaning, and reassembling this assembly becomes far more manageable when you understand the function of each part.

The primary component, bearing the name of the entire assembly, is the slide. This is the part that you manually move when charging the shotgun and that travels back and forth during the firing cycle. The slide is a sturdy, metal component that houses the bolt and serves as the framework for many of the assembly’s moving parts. This assembly also provides a platform for the operating handle.

The bolt is the core of the assembly. It’s a substantial, often machined, component that holds the extractor and firing pin. The bolt performs the crucial task of locking and unlocking the action. When the shotgun is fired, the bolt remains firmly locked against the barrel, providing a secure seal and containing the explosive force of the gunpowder. As the slide moves backward, the bolt disengages from the barrel, allowing for the extraction of the spent shell casing.

Attached to the bolt, the extractor is the part that grasps and pulls the spent shell casing from the chamber. It’s a small but critical part, and the extractor is often a point of potential malfunction. If worn or damaged, it may fail to extract the spent casing, causing a jam. Regular inspection and replacement, if necessary is critical for the proper function of the Ithaca Model 51.

The action bar is a long, slender metal component that connects the slide to the bolt assembly. As the slide moves back and forth, the action bar transfers this movement to the bolt, causing it to unlock, extract the spent casing, load a new shell, and lock the action.

The link is a smaller, yet crucial component. It connects the action bar to the bolt and facilitates the unlocking and locking sequence. The link provides the necessary mechanical advantage to rotate the bolt.

The operating handle, also known as the charging handle, is the part that the user physically manipulates to cycle the action, load the first shell, and clear the chamber. It is attached to the slide assembly, and its movement directly translates into movement of the slide and all its constituent parts.

Taking it Apart: Disassembly Procedures

Before embarking on any disassembly process, safety must be your top priority.

Safety First

  • Verify the Shotgun is Unloaded: Open the action and physically inspect the chamber and magazine to ensure that they are empty of any ammunition.
  • Remove the Barrel: Detach the barrel from the receiver, following the manufacturer’s instructions. This allows safer access and prevents accidental damage.
  • Work in a Clean, Well-Lit Area: This allows you to find any small parts that might drop and makes the process more pleasant.

Step-by-Step Disassembly

  1. Separate the Slide Assembly from the Receiver: With the barrel removed and the action open, locate the slide release. Press the slide release and pull the slide assembly rearward and out of the receiver.
  2. Remove the Operating Handle: This is typically secured by a pin or some form of retention. Use a punch and hammer to gently tap the pin out. The operating handle can then be removed from the slide.
  3. Remove the Bolt from the Slide: The bolt is usually held in place by a bolt retainer. Release the bolt retainer, which may be a small pin or spring, and the bolt can be slid out of the slide.
  4. Disassemble the Bolt: Once the bolt is separated from the slide, you can disassemble the bolt itself.
    • Carefully remove the firing pin retaining pin.
    • Gently push the firing pin out of the bolt.
    • Take out the extractor. Note how it’s positioned.
  5. Remove Other Components: If there are any other components, such as springs or retainers, carefully remove them. Make sure you keep track of the orientation of the parts.

Cleaning and Inspection

After disassembly, clean each part thoroughly using a gun-cleaning solvent. A soft brush can help remove stubborn debris. Pay close attention to any areas where carbon buildup tends to accumulate. Inspect each component for any signs of wear, damage, or fatigue. Look for:

  • Cracks: In the slide, bolt, and action bar.
  • Excessive wear: On the bolt face, extractor, and locking lugs.
  • Corrosion: In any part of the slide assembly.
  • Deformed springs: Any springs that have lost their tension.

If you discover any worn or damaged components, they should be replaced. Proper inspection and the maintenance of the Ithaca Model 51 slide assembly are critical for longevity.

Putting it Back Together: Reassembly Procedures

Reassembling the slide assembly is the reverse process of disassembly. Following these steps carefully will ensure you have a functional and safe firearm.

Preparation

Before reassembling, make sure all the components are completely clean and dry. Lubricate each component, using a high-quality gun oil, to ensure smooth movement and to protect against corrosion.

Reassembly Steps

  1. Reassemble the Bolt:
    • Insert the extractor back into the bolt in the correct orientation.
    • Insert the firing pin and re-insert the firing pin retaining pin.
  2. Insert the Bolt into the Slide: Carefully slide the bolt back into the slide.
  3. Reattach the Bolt Retainer: Secure the bolt in the slide with the bolt retainer.
  4. Reattach the Operating Handle: Align the operating handle and reinsert its retaining pin.
  5. Reinstall the Slide Assembly: Carefully insert the slide assembly back into the receiver.
  6. Attach the Barrel: Reattach the barrel to the receiver.

Function Testing

After reassembly, it’s essential to test the function of the slide assembly.

  • Cycle the Action: Manually cycle the action several times. The action should move smoothly, and the bolt should fully lock into place.
  • Check for Smooth Extraction: Make sure that the extractor securely grabs a dummy shell and extracts it from the chamber.
  • Firing Pin Function: Verify the firing pin extends from the bolt face.

If the action doesn’t cycle smoothly, or if you encounter any resistance, immediately stop and re-inspect the assembly for any errors. Sometimes a small piece of debris or a slightly misaligned part can cause functionality problems.

Troubleshooting Common Problems

Even with careful maintenance, problems can arise with the slide assembly. Knowing the common issues and their potential causes can help you diagnose and resolve problems efficiently.

Failure to Feed

  • Potential Causes:
    • A dirty or damaged extractor.
    • A weak or damaged magazine spring.
    • A dirty or damaged chamber.
  • Solutions:
    • Clean the extractor.
    • Replace the extractor.
    • Replace the magazine spring.
    • Clean the chamber thoroughly.

Failure to Eject

  • Potential Causes:
    • A broken or worn extractor.
    • A dirty or damaged chamber.
    • Weak or missing ejector.
  • Solutions:
    • Replace the extractor.
    • Clean the chamber.
    • Replace the ejector.

Bolt Not Locking

  • Potential Causes:
    • Worn or damaged locking lugs on the bolt.
    • Debris interfering with the action.
  • Solutions:
    • Replace the bolt or have it repaired.
    • Clean the action thoroughly.

Sticky Action

  • Potential Causes:
    • Lack of lubrication.
    • Dirt or debris in the action.
  • Solutions:
    • Thoroughly clean and lubricate the slide assembly.

Other Issues

  • Short Stroking: If the action does not fully cycle, the spring can be weak.
  • Misfires: This could be caused by a broken firing pin, or an obstruction.

Maintenance Practices for Peak Performance

To keep your Ithaca Model 51 running reliably, consistent maintenance is essential.

Regular Cleaning and Lubrication

After each shooting session, or more often if necessary, clean and lubricate the slide assembly.

  • Cleaning: Use a gun-cleaning solvent to remove carbon, dirt, and other debris. Use brushes and patches to reach all areas.
  • Lubrication: Apply high-quality gun oil to all moving parts. A light coat is sufficient; excessive lubrication can attract dirt.

Inspections

Regularly inspect the slide assembly for any signs of wear or damage. Look for:

  • Cracks: In the slide, bolt, and action bar.
  • Wear: On the bolt face, extractor, and locking lugs.
  • Corrosion: In any of the components.

Replacement Parts

If you discover any worn or damaged parts, replace them promptly. Replacement parts are readily available from many online retailers and gun parts suppliers. Choose quality parts to ensure reliability.
